Output c7964371f1a01a20c0b53054bdcb873daedff16447c93edafed93cde61779f0b:0

value
1495692552
script pubkey
OP_0 OP_PUSHBYTES_20 ae15d200c0ab240bdb9073e25b6cbf2939bc95b4
address
bc1q4c2ayqxq4vjqhkusw039km9l9yume9d5hnyae8
transaction
c7964371f1a01a20c0b53054bdcb873daedff16447c93edafed93cde61779f0b
spent
true